Discover Your Computer's Standard Browser
Ever investigated which browser your computer automatically utilizes when you click on a link? Well, determining your default browser is easier than you think! It can be helpful to know this for various reasons, such as troubleshooting web browsing issues or simply understanding your system's settings.
To find your default browser, you can usually check the system settings on your operating system. This is typically located in the system preferences. Look for a section related to "Web Browser" or "Default Apps".
- Similarly, you can right-click on an internet link and select "Open With" from the context menu. This will give you a list of available browsers, with your default one usually listed on top.
